Weeds

Scroll below to learn more about the weeds that could be attacking your lawn.
The weeds are separated into two categories: Grassy Weeds and Broadleaf Weeds. Grassy Weeds

Picture of a weed called tall fescue, which is a grassy weed

Tall Fescue

Characteristics:
  • Bunch-like growing patterns
  • Individual stems in bunches
  • Can reach 3-4 ft in height
  • Large, dark green leaves
Picture of a grassy weed called dallis grass

Dallis Grass

Characteristics:
  • Coarse, grows in bunches
  • Firework burst or star shape​
  • 2-6 inch stems grow from center point
  • Minimal long stems with seed heads
  • Seeds are dormant in winter, sprout in early spring.
Picture of a crabgrass weed, a grassy type of weed, large crabgrass

Large Crabgrass

Characteristics:
  • Micro-hairs covering all parts.
  • Leaves with wavy edges
  • Mostly a deep green color
  • Summer annual that emerges every spring
  • Can indicate heightened soil temperatures
Picture

Smooth Crabgrass

Characteristics:
  • Smooth Crabgrass is the most common summer weed- 90% of crabgrass in MI is smooth crabgrass.
  • Wavy-edged leaves
  • Light green color
  • Summer annual that emerges every spring
Picture of a weed called quackgrass, a grassy weed, very similar to a grass

Quackgrass

Characteristics:
  • Light green-blue green blades
  • Rough on top surface of blades
  • Flowers resembles wheat
  • Turns brown in summer
  • Grows quickly in spring and fall


Image of a grassy weed called yellow nutsedge.

Yellow Nutsedge

Characteristics:
  • Very grass-like appearance
  • Triangular stem with three leaves
  • Perennial that is symptomatic of poorly drained soil
  • Will grow faster than surrounding grass
  • Seed heads appear July-October

Broadleaf Weeds

Picture of a broadleaf weed called the broadleaf plantain

Broadleaf Plantain 

Characteristics:​
  • Grayish-green oval leaves 
  • Grows in rosettes that sit tight to the ground
  • Thin seed heads sprout in clusters in the center
    • These stalks appear from early summer to september.

This weed tends to overwhelm and suffocate your grass.

Clover

Characteristics:
  • Compound leaves with 3 leaflets
  • Lighter colored triangle in the center of individual leaflets
  • Little teeth on edge of leaves
  • Appear from May to September.
  • Flowers small white and purple flowers.

Spurge

Characteristics:
  • Low-growing
  • Reddish & somewhat hairy stems
  • Broken stems produce milky white substance much like a dandelion
  • Often found in: parking lot islands, crevices, and poorly drained bark mulch.
  • Summer annual

Common Purslane

Characteristics:
  • Red stems
  • Thick leaves, resemble a jade plant
  • Flowers yellow buds that only open when sunny
  • Low-growing summer annual
  • Prefers sidewalk crevices, mulched flower beds and any type of soil.

Dandelion

Characteristics:
  • Lance-shaped leaves in rosettes.
  • Flowers in bright yellow
  • Flowers become fluffy seed-heads
  • Seedlings are capable of germination anytime throughout their growing season
  • Present from early spring to fall.

Wild Violet

Characteristics:
  • Flowers from a deep violet to complete white
  • Heart-shaped, waxy leaves
  • Dense root system
  • Perennial often found in shaded areas, preferring moist soil.
  • Flowers appear mid-may

Ground Ivy

Characteristics:
  • ​Also known as creeping charlie
  • Round leaves with bumpy edges
  • Square stems
  • When broken, leaves give off a minty smell.
  • Flowers blue/purple funnel-shaped flowers.

Oxalis

Characteristics:
  • Most notable for its bright yellow flowers.
  • Grows upright, but appears as a creeping vine.
  • Stems/leaves are purplish/reddish
  • Perennial

Black Medic

Characteristics:
  • 3 petal leaflets similar to clover
  • Flowers very small bright yellow
  • Grows low to the ground
  • Hairy stems
  • Common May- September.

English Daisy 

Characteristics:​
  • Daisy-like flowers 
  • Leaves can be both smooth and hairy
  • 2-inch stalks 
  • Grow in dense clusters
  • Grow quickly in spring and fall
